KUCHING: All divisional and district disaster management committees should be on high alert due to the current hot and dry weather conditions, said Datuk Amar Douglas Uggah Embas.

The chairman of Sarawak Disaster Management Committee (SDMC) noted that northern Sarawak is particularly affected by the current weather conditions.

“This has resulted in some areas, namely settlements already experiencing water supply problems.

“In this regard, all the divisional disaster management committees are required to be fully aware and to treat the situation seriously.

“They are instructed to assess the severity of the problem in their respective divisions and to render immediately the necessary assistance, like in providing water supply to affected settlements,” he said in a press statement issued today (Mar 21).

Uggah added all the relevant divisional agencies especially Fire and Rescue Department (Bomba), Malaysian Civil Defence Force (APM), Sarawak Rural Water Supply Department (JBALB) and Sarawak Public Works Department (PWD) must work closely with the divisional committee in facing and addressing this problem.

“In addition, the public are advised to take the necessary precautions.

“Do not hesitate to visit the nearest clinic for treatment if they encounter any medical problems due to the situation,” he said.
